There is a branch hanging from a tree on the bank of a lake. It is at a height of `h_(1)` from the surface of water. A diver under water sees it at height of `h_(2)` . What is the relation between `h_(1) and h_(2)`? Given, `mu_(w) = 1.33`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

As the object is situated in a rarer medium and it is seen from the denser medium,
`mu = (("apparent heigher of the object")/("from the surface of water"))/(("real heigher of the object")/("from the surface of water")) = (h_(2))/(h_(1))`
`or, " " 1.33 = (h_(2))/(h_(1)) or, h_(2) = 1.33 h_(1)`
